58 Too many trays attached
1Turn the printer off.
2Unplug the power cord from the wall outlet.
Note: Optional trays lock together when stacked. Rem ove stacked trays one at a time from the top down.
3Remove the additional trays.
4Connect the power cord to a properly grounded outlet.
5Turn the printer back on.

84 PC Kit life warning
The photoconductor kit is near exhaustion .
Try one or more of the following:
Replace the photoconductor kit.
Press the up or down arrow button until Continue appears, and then press to cl ear the message and
continue printing.
84 Replace PC Kit
The photoconductor kit is exhausted. Inst all a new photoconductor kit.
88 Cartridge low
The toner is low. Replace the toner cartridge, and then press the up o r down arrow button until Continue appears,
and then press to clear the message an d continue printing.
1565 Emulation error, load emulation option
The printer automatically clears the message in 30 seconds and then disables the download emulato r on the firmware
card.
To fix this, download the correct download emulator version from the Lexmark Web site at www.lexmark.com.
